Overview

Add this replacement numbering head to your Count™ NumberPro Numbering, Perforating and Scoring Machine. This electric numberer head is capable of recessing the first four wheels to prevent those images from striking; for example, giving you 912 instead of 0000912. Change the rotation direction from forward to reverse by just twisting the U-frame and rotating the wheels in either direction. This Numbering Head can number single sheets or crash number up through 6 part carbonless forms. You can number your sheets up to 12 times per sheet and place the numbers anywhere on the sheet from the leading edge to within 1mm of the previous impression.

Description

Need an additional electric head for your NumberPro Numbering Machine? This Numbering Head can number single sheets or crash number up through an 8 part carbonless form. Has and optional letterwheel No, blank, dash and A-G, H-P, or R-Z. Each numbering head can be programmed individually for multiple numbering. Numbers vertically and horizontally- heads swivel 360°. Numbers virtually anywhere on a sheet, from lead edge and numbers within .1" of previous number. Part Number is CNUMPRO18HEAD.

Features:

  • Number single sheets or crash number up through an 8 part carbonless form
  • Deluxe (7) wheel Gothic reverse numbering heads offer (5) repeat sequences: 0,1,2,3 & 6, and 3 drop-away zeros.
  • Optional 6-wheel or 8-wheel Gothic reverse numbering heads. (Repeat sequences will vary on 6 or 8 wheel heads and these heads are a special order)
  • Optional letterwheel No, blank, dash and A-G, H-P, or R-Z.
  • Each numbering head can be programmed individually for multiple numbering.
  • Numbers vertically and horizontally- heads swivel 360°.
  • Numbers virtually anywhere on a sheet, from lead edge and numbers within .1" of previous number.

Frequent Asked Questions

Q
I have had for a while and the numbers just started sticking - how do I stop that?
Asked by Joseph
A
Regular cleaning of the numbering head will solve this problem. You can clean the numbering head wheel by soaking it in Simple Green or a similar cleaner. Use a tooth brush to scrub the wheels of the wheelset then blow out with compressed air.

Q
How to number the same thing multiple times
Asked by Camilla
A
To number the same number multiple times you can set the repeat selector. This allows you to select the number of times that the head will strike without advancing to the next number. For example, if you need to number a job that requires the same number in two (2) positions, slide the selector to “2.” The head will now strike the same number twice.

After selecting a repeat sequence, replace the head and run a test sheet. If you are still having trouble with this setting, please refer to the user manual for additional instructions.

Q
The impression is ghosting a bit on the edges. How do I adjust the numbering head to make it clear from edge-to-edge?
Asked by William
A
Leveling the numbering head is the most critical part of the setup process. If the head is not level you will get a blurred or “Ghosted” Impression. This can also occur when the head is set to hit too lightly or too heavy. Never set pressure to favor the drop wheels, for this will depreciate the life of the numbering wheels.

The easiest way to check your impression is to use a 3 part carbonless set. Program the Auto Pro Plus to stamp in one location anywhere on the sheet. Run your test sheet through the machine and check the impression for pressure as well as levelness. By level we mean a level impression. Where the impression of the 1st digit is the same pressure and impression as the 5th and 6th digit and the top of the digits is the same as the bottom you are level. We do not mean “plumb level,” as using a small level will not help.

Q
How do I make it number without 0's? I need to start with number 100 and don't want 000100. Thanks!
Asked by Heather
A
The standard Electric Numbering Head is capable of recessing the first four (4) wheels so there is no image when striking. For example, to print 100 instead of 000100, you will need to depress the first 4 wheels.

To do so, remove the Numbering Head from the Head Bracket and hold it upside down resting it on a flat surface. By doing this you will activate the Test Print button. This will keep the head in the “Open or Down” position for as long as the button is depressed. This will swing the Ink Cartridge away from the wheels or you can remove it altogether. Using the provided set-up tool rotate the 1st wheel until the 9 is in the up position. Then press forward slightly and down, you will feel the wheel depress below the level of the others. Do the same to the 2nd and 3rd wheel. Now you can print a 4 digit number.

To return to position, simply rotate the wheel and it will pop up. This feature is also available on the custom Numbering Wheel with letters. Rotate the wheel until the blank position is up then press forward and down.
